In this paper, we propose an automated verification approach that enables the validation of whether policies are met in a virtual environment and supports the analysis of the results. This proposed approach constructs a virtual environment based on NCM (description of network configuration), allowing for the output of a validation result table indicating whether the states of devices match the L2-L3 CRDD (the intended state of each device as envisioned by the designer). Experiments were conducted to evaluate the proposed approach's effectiveness. By inputting correct L2-L3 CRDD and incorrect NCM, error locations were analyzed. The proposed approach effectively narrowed down error locations, demonstrating its potential efficacy.","subitem_description_type":"Other"}]},"item_4_biblio_info_10":{"attribute_name":"書誌情報","attribute_value_mlt":[{"bibliographicPageEnd":"8","bibliographic_titles":[{"bibliographic_title":"研究報告インターネットと運用技術(IOT)"}],"bibliographicPageStart":"1","bibliographicIssueDates":{"bibliographicIssueDate":"2024-03-05","bibliographicIssueDateType":"Issued"},"bibliographicIssueNumber":"4","bibliographicVolumeNumber":"2024-IOT-64"}]},"relation_version_is_last":true,"weko_creator_id":"44499"},"created":"2025-01-19T01:34:13.563954+00:00","id":233024,"links":{}}
